Solar power generation can be divided into two technological schemes: photovoltaic (PV) and concentrating solar power (CSP). The principle of CSP generation is to utilize large-scale mirrors to collect solar thermal energy, heat it through a heat exchanger to produce water steam, and then supply it to traditional turbine generators for electricity generation .

Worldwide electricity storage operating capacity totals 159,000 MW, or about 6,400 MW if pumped hydro storage is excluded. The DOE data is current as of February 2020 (Sandia 2020). Pumped hydro makes up 152 GW or 96% of worldwide energy storage capacity operating today.

Flywheels and Compressed Air Energy Storage also make up a large part of the market. The largest country share of capacity (excluding pumped hydro) is in the United States (33%), followed by Spain and Germany. The United Kingdom and South Africa round out the top five countries.
